Gasket extrusion plays a crucial role in various industries, including automotive, aerospace, and manufacturing. This process involves forming continuous lengths of gasket material, typically elastomers or foam, into shapes that fit specific applications. These extrusions provide essential sealing solutions that prevent leakage and protect sensitive components from contamination.

Optimizing truck and container door seals is crucial for ensuring the integrity and durability of cargo during transport. One effective solution is the use of co-extruded PVC rubber gaskets, which offer a range of benefits that enhance performance and longevity. These gaskets are designed with advanced properties such as anti-zone, anti-aging, and excellent weather resistance, ensuring that they can withstand the rigors of extended outdoor exposure. Their unique formulation also provides superior flexibility and elasticity, allowing them to maintain their shape and effectiveness even under extreme conditions.
The incorporation of unique metal clamps and tongue clasps within the gaskets ensures a firm yet flexible installation, making it easier to create a tight seal. This feature is crucial as it contributes to excellent fire and water resistance, protecting cargo from unexpected hazards. Furthermore, the gaskets exhibit impressive thermal range capabilities, with PVC tolerant to temperatures as low as -29ºC and as high as 65.5ºC, while EPDM performs even better in extreme conditions, ranging from -40ºC to 120ºC. This reliability in varying temperatures, combined with good dimensional tolerance and outstanding compression ability, makes co-extruded PVC rubber gaskets an ideal choice for optimizing truck and container door seals, thereby ensuring that every journey is secure and efficient.
